Overview

This document has been prepared by Working Committee NA 062-03-13 AA "Gemeinschaftsarbeitsausschuss NA 062/FGSV: Gesteinskörnungen; Prüfverfahren, Petrographie, Probenahme und Präzision" ("Joint working group NA 062/FGSV: Aggregates; test methods, petrography, sampling and precision") at the Materials Testing Standards Committee (NMP). This document specifies methods for sampling aggregates. The purpose of sampling is to obtain a test portion suitable for the determination of one or more characteristic(s) of a basic population. With this test portion, it is intended to determine the average quality or deviations from the average quality of the basic population. The basic population can be a rock deposit, production volume, delivery quantity, quantity of the partial delivery (for example cargo), stock or a structure (for example revetment).
